Ethereum dived from the $417 swing high and traded below $350 against the US Dollar. ETH price is currently recovering above $375 and it is likely to climb back above $400.

After a strong rally above $350 and $400, Ethereum faced a significant bearish move against the US Dollar. A high was formed near $417 before the price tumbled (similar to bitcoin and ripple) below $400 and $350.

The price even spiked below the $330 support level and the 100 hourly simple moving average. However, it found a strong buying interest near $305 and $300. Ether recovered sharply above the $330 and $350 levels.

There was a break above the $365 and $370 levels. The price is now trading near the $385 resistance zone. It is close to the 50% Fib retracement level of the recent decline from the $416 swing high to $353 swing low. It seems like there is a key contracting triangle forming with resistance near $385 on the hourly chart of ETH/USD.

If ether price breaks the triangle resistance, it could test the $390 resistance. The 61.8% Fib retracement level of the recent decline from the $416 swing high to $353 swing low is also near the $392 level.

A successful break above the triangle resistance and $392 could open the doors for a fresh increase above the $400 level. In the mentioned case, the price is likely to rise towards the $415 and $420 levels in the coming sessions.

The triangle support is near the $378 level. If there is a bearish break below the triangle support, Ethereum could test the $365 support.

The next major support is near the $360 level and the 100 hourly SMA, where the bulls are likely to take a strong stand. Any further losses could lead the price towards the $300 handle.

NASA’s most advanced rover heads to Mars – UPI News

ORLANDO, Fla., July 30 (UPI) -- NASA launched the most advanced Mars rover yet -- with technology and tools to find signs of life on the Red Planet -- on Thursday morning from Cape Canaveral Air Force Station in Florida.

The spacecraft that carries the Perseverance rover, which also is ferrying the first helicopter designed to fly on another planet, separated from its rocket just under an hour after the launch at 7:50 a.m. EDT.

The Atlas V rocket launched with "2.3 million pounds of thrust to take aim at Mars" and headed toward Mars at over 25,000 miles per hour, according to NASA and launch company United Launch Alliance.

NASA's rover now joins the United Arab Emirates' Hope orbiter and China's Tianwen-1 probe, which also includes a rover, on the trip to Mars this summer.

As with the other two missions, Thursday's launch begins a seven-month journey that will end at Mars in February. NASA predicts a Feb. 18 landing on Mars.

NASA officials said they had to adjust communication networks on Earth because the signal from the spacecraft was too strong at first, but otherwise the spacecraft's navigation system indicated it was on the right path.

Trajectory corrections

The agency has 15 days before it must make the first trajectory corrections, if needed, said Matt Wallace, NASA's deputy program manager for the mission.

Wallace noted that NASA overcame workplace restrictions due to the coronavirus pandemic to make a deadline for launching this summer while Mars was close to the Earth's orbit.

"In dealing with pandemic, it really took the entire agency to step up and help us, and they didn't hesitate and they did it, and we really appreciate that," Wallace said.

The mission, like any trip to Mars, comes with a lot of risks, NASA Administrator Jim Bridenstine said in a press conference in Florida on Wednesday.

"It's without question, a challenge. I mean we, there's no other way to put it, and it's not easy. ... That being said, we know how to land on Mars. We've done it eight times already," Bridenstine said.

This year's mission to Mars builds on the past discoveries made by rovers such as Spirit, Opportunity and Curiosity, which led NASA to conclude that conditions once existed to support life there.

"Mars 2020 is without question the most advanced mission to Mars, including the two other missions headed there this year from China and the United Arab Emirates," said Raymond Arvidson, professor of Earth and Planetary Sciences at Washington University in St. Louis.

Arvidson has been involved in every Mars mission since Viking 1 landed on the Red Planet in 1976.

Top-notch instruments

"The instruments on board are unmatched, and the planned return of Martian soil and rock samples is also historic," Arvidson said.

The mission's primary goal is to study rocks at or just below the surface for signs that life existed, or still exists, on Mars, and to understand its geology better.

The rover also will collect rock samples for return to Earth during a future mission, but NASA said that could take 10 years to accomplish.

NASA announced the Mars 2020 rover mission in 2012, at an estimated cost of $1.5 billion, but the budget has swelled to $2.46 billion. Work on components started in 2017, and construction of the rover started to stream over a live webcam in June 2019.

The Atlas rocket carrying the rover had four solid-rocket strap-on boosters in addition to the main, first-stage booster. That is the same configuration used to launch NASA's Curiosity rover to Mars in 2011.

Mars 2020 and the Perseverance rover are scheduled to land at the large Jezero Crater amid that planet's Northern Lowlands. Scientists believe that once was home to a river delta.

The rover will select targets for rock samples, drive and operate for at least one Mars year, which is about two Earth years.

Besides its science and imaging instruments, the Perseverance rover also carries the Ingenuity helicopter strapped to its underside. The aircraft is powered by lithium-ion batteries that can recharge via solar panels.

Ingenuity is made up of a box carrying cameras and instruments, four spindly landing legs and two counter-rotating rotors. The rover will film the helicopter as it flies.

NASA describes Ingenuity as primarily an experiment to prove it can fly an aircraft on another planet and record images.

Ingenuity is considered a demonstration of a new technology, and NASA believes it could help to identify interesting targets for future Mars exploration. The helicopter's first flight is scheduled for two months after the rover lands.

Boston Dynamics CEO Rob Playter is coming to Disrupt 2020 to talk robotics and automation – TechCrunch

Back in January, Robert Playter became the CEO of Boston Dynamics. It was a momentous occasion, marking the companys first new CEO since its founding in the early 1990s when the company was founded by Marc Raibert. The move came during what was already a transitional period for the company which is why we are excited to chat with him at Disrupt 2020.

Following its sale to Softbank, Boston Dynamics had recently begun early sales of Spot, its first commercial product. In April of last year, the company made its own acquisition, picking up Bay Area-based Kinema Systems to help design a visioning system for its own warehouse robotics like Handle.

Of course, much of this pre-dates the current COVID-19 pandemic, which has made automation and robotics an even more hot button issue than it has been in the years prior. Over the course of the last few months, Spot has been seen employed in a factotum of different jobs, as everyone from construction companies to health care facilities to baseball teams look to the quadrupedal robot for help.

Playter will be making his first public speaking engagement as CEO at our first online-only Disrupt this September. His appearance comes after several from Boston Dynamics founder (and Playters predecessor as CEO) Marc Raibert. Most recently, Raibert made a return appearance at our TC Sessions: Robotics event last April to show off the commercial version of Spot.

He will join us to discuss the challenges and opportunities in transforming Boston Dynamics into commercial venture at Disrupt 2020on September 14-18. Robots: What you need to know about the past, present and future of robotics – BBC Focus Magazine

What are robots and what can they do?

Robots are machines that can carry out complex actions automatically. They generally need three elements: sensors such as cameras, lidar, or microphones; actuators such as motors, pistons or artificial muscles, and controllers.

Robots may be remotely controlled by humans, but frequently they are partially or fully controlled by computers, making them autonomous.

Robots in fiction frequently resemble us, looking quite humanoid in appearance with two arms, two legs and a head with cameras for eyes. But in reality, the vast majority of robot forms are designed to fit their function.

Your washing machine and dishwasher are both robots, performing complex actions under computer control. Many air-conditioning units are robots, changing fan settings, air deflectors, and switching from cooling to heating automatically.

All modern cars are robots, with computers adjusting engine settings, brakes, steering and suspension in response to your driving.

The more advanced autonomous cars are even starting to take over some of the driving from you.

The word robot derives from the Czech word robota, meaning forced labour, which was derived from the Proto-Slavic *orbota, meaning hard work or slavery.

In 1920, Karel apek introduced the word robot to the world in his play called Rossumovi Univerzln Roboti (Rossums Universal Robots) in which artificial organic humanoid robots were built, and subsequently became dissatisfied, leading to a robot revolution and ultimately the birth of a new robot society.

Similar storylines have been used in movies about robots ever since.

Czech author Karel apek in 1938 Erich Auerbach/Getty Images

apeks robots were not mechanical, unlike ours today. But more recently the word robot or bot is also used in reference to software, for example a Web-crawling bot that trawls through websites collating information.

Given the original meaning and origin of the word, you have to wonder if one day an intelligent artificial entity will consider robot to be highly offensive and derogatory.

The field of robotics, and more broadly mechatronics, studies how best to design, build and control robots.

Its surprisingly difficult to make robots that work well. Information from sensors must be processed in real-time (if you cannot make sense of what you see quickly enough, then you either have to move very slowly, or you have to keep stopping to think).

More flexible robots such as robot arms in factories have many degrees of freedom (imagine an arm with five elbows as well as a shoulder and wrist joint). Such arms can be moved into billions of different twisty poses to enable them to reach into tricky places and weld components together.

Figuring out how best to control robot arms so that they do not hit anything (including themselves) is surprisingly hard, especially when obstacles may be moving around them. Thats why, despite all the amazing things artificial intelligence (AI) can do today, robot control is still considered one of the most difficult problems.

Its also why creating fully autonomous vehicles is a lot more difficult than most people realise!

The idea of automata has been around for thousands of years. These devices were mechanical representations of animals, birds and people, often designed to entertain the wealthy.

Ancient Chinese texts tell the story of a mechanical man presented to King Mu of Zhou (1023957 BCE) by the artificer Yan Shi. King Solomon, who reigned from 970 to 931 BCE, was said to have had a golden lion that raised a foot to help him to his throne, and a mechanical eagle that placed his crown upon his head. Hero of Alexandria (1070 CE) wrote an entire book about his automaton inventions, and how hydraulics, pneumatics and mechanics could be used.

Some of the first robots as we might recognise them today were built in the 1940s by neurologist and EEG pioneer Grey Walter in Bristol, UK. Since they looked a little like electric tortoises, he called them Elmer and Elsie (ELectro MEchanical Robots, Light Sensitive). These fully autonomous robots trundled about, attracted to light like moths, and automatically went back to charge themselves when their batteries became low.

Robots have contributed massively to our industries, enabling most devices, appliances, transportation and processed foods to be made efficiently and cheaply. Today researchers are working towards even greater automation, with robots taking over more and more of the manufacturing processes.

3D printing using additive manufacturing may enable complex components to be made, and it is the ambition of many industries to even automate the repair process of machines, with faults being detected before they cause failures, and new parts being made and swapped automatically.

Eventually, this could even lead to machines that can build themselves and repair themselves known as von Neumann machines (self-replicating machines) after the mathematician who imagined them back in the late 1940s.

In our homes, robots are likely to become more common. Robot vacuum cleaners and floor-moppers may become the norm instead of a luxury, although theyre unlikely ever to look like Rosey the Robot from the Jetsons. Robot kitchen arms to do your cooking might become common.

At present, there are no practical robot dusters, however!

The science fiction writer and professor of biochemistry, Isaac Asimov, wrote many early books about robots. (The movie I, Robot was based on his books, and his Foundation series is now being made for a new Apple TV series.)

He famously created three laws of robotics:

But while these laws were a fictional attempt to protect us from harm, they didnt really work as Asimovs own stories often demonstrated. Tell the robot, he is not a human being, or neglect to tell them that he is a human, or tell the robot that something else is a human being and all kinds of problems could happen.

Today, no robot uses these three laws. Instead, we have experts in AI, ethics and morals to help provide sensible guidelines for the creation and use of robots. Some researchers also hope to empower robots and give them the ability to judge ethical and moral consequences for themselves.

Coronavirus, mental health, and the spiritual life: A priest psychologist offers tips from St. Ignatius – Catholic News Agency

CNA Staff, Jul 31, 2020 / 10:00 am MT (CNA).- Since 2014, Fr. Roger Dawson has run a retreat house in the idyllic countryside of north Wales. When the U.K. went into lockdown in March, he was forced to cancel retreats. But he was determined to find a new way of offering spiritual direction.

After talking to other priests at St. Beunos Jesuit Spirituality Centre, he launched a telephone service for those struggling to cope with the pressures of the coronavirus crisis.

He said the service was extremely well received, with around 150 people taking part in one-to-one conversations with clergy.

Dawson, who served in the British Army for nine years before training as a clinical psychologist, told CNA that the phone conversations revealed common problems. He also discussed how the Catholic faith can alleviate them.

The most common experience was fear. Dawson said this was to be expected because of the deadly nature of COVID-19, which has claimed the lives of more than 46,000 people in the U.K. -- the third highest recorded death toll in the world.

But he suggested that the official response to the crisis could have a long-lasting psychological impact.

In order to get people to comply, the government frightened people. That may well have been necessary, but the difficulty is that once you frighten people, its really quite difficult to unfrighten them. People havent necessarily got all the knowledge or skills to identify what the risks are, he said.

He recommended meditating on the Gospels as a way of combating fear, highlighting Matthew 5, in which Jesus proclaims the Beatitudes.

He also encouraged people to reflect on Jesus instruction to his disciples to Be not afraid. This didnt mean that nothing bad would ever happen to followers of Jesus, he said, but rather that Not even death can destroy the love of God.

The psychology of crisis

Dawson said that one helpful way of looking at the pandemic was through personal constructive theory, a concept pioneered by the American psychologist George Kelly in the 1950s.

What personal construct theory is saying is that were basically meaning-makers, he said. As a result of our experience, and what weve learnt and been told, we build mental maps that help us to navigate our way around the world, and to understand ourselves, our situation and other people. And wise people are people who have very sophisticated and detailed maps.

He continued: What happens in a crisis is that something happens, new information comes in, that simply does not fit this map, and one of the things thats so destabilizing for people is not just the event itself, but I cant make sense of this. I thought I was safe and Ive discovered I live in a highly dangerous world.

All your expectations about what the future would hold, or how these relationships work, or how people relate to you or treat you, totally changes and it needs a different map in order for the person to navigate the experience. At the beginning of the crisis, they havent got a map that works for this experience.

Dawson said this process could be seen in the biblical story of the road to Emmaus, where Jesus presents the disciples with a new map to understand the events in Jerusalem.

But accepting a new map required a lot of psychological energy, he explained, and often people experience anger or despair before they do so.

In some ways, thats what were having to do spiritually all the time, he said. Any Catholic who simply resolutely holds on to the map that they were given when they were catechized for their First Holy Communion isnt going to get very far in their spiritual lives and grow and deepen in their knowledge and understanding of God, because those maps are for young children, not for adults whove got to cope with the world and life experience.

So a lot of what were doing at St. Beunos is helping people to deepen their understanding of God and be changed, and think about things differently, and live differently and live more deeply, with a better map.

What we need to thrive

Dawson noted that another common experience during the pandemic was depression. He said that a concept known as self-determination theory could help to explain why.

Self-determination theory is a theory about human flourishing and conditions needed for people to thrive, he explained. The theory quite simply states that we have basic psychological needs, in the same way that we have basic physical needs.

These are: the need for a sense of autonomy -- to have some sense of control and agency in your life and environment; the need for a sense of relatedness -- to be connected with people who care about us, love us and who will talk to us and show interest in us; and a need for a sense of competence -- that is, to be doing the things were good at or, if were asked to do things were not good at, were getting the support and help from other people to get the scaffolding so that we can achieve.

If these needs are met, people thrive, reliably and predictably. The crisis has deprived people of their sense of autonomy. Its deprived people of a lot of their relationships or, in many cases, put things under severe strain. And its deprived people of doing things theyre good at.

Dawson cited a University College London study which found that both depression and anxiety levels have fallen as the lockdown has eased.

You probably would expect peoples reaction to fear to settle down. Part of its biologically driven because the adrenaline and cortisol which fires up the system just calms down after a while. So you would expect people to get used to the anxiety and for it to settle. But the absence of depression and the absence of anxiety doesnt equal flourishing, he said.

Dawson described his own experience during the crisis as one of attrition. He compared it to a four-and-a-half month tour of duty he undertook in Northern Ireland in the 1980s and a five-month stint in the Falkland Islands shortly after the war between Argentina and the U.K. in 1982.

Since he arrived at St. Beunos (pronounced St. Bye-nos), he has regularly climbed Snowdonia, the highest mountain in England and Wales.

He said: For the months of April and May, which were beautiful here, Ive been able to see those mountains but not go there. So theres that sense of attrition, of being cut off from things that refill the tanks.

Missing the sacraments

Dawson said that Catholics faced a specific challenge during the lockdown: the absence of the sacraments. He suggested that for many people this was a traumatic experience.

The thing that I think is so powerful about our sacramental system is that it makes our faith physical and flesh and blood, he said.

All of our sacraments are to do with flesh and blood, not just in terms of the Eucharist. Its another flesh-and-blood person who anoints you. Its a flesh-and-blood person who speaks the words of absolution. This is the way that our faith is made incarnate. For the faith to be made disincarnate like that I think for many will have been traumatic.

Yet, he said, this period of deprivation could be an opportunity for spiritual growth.

The thing about a crisis is that it forces us to rethink things. Any crisis has the potential to reveal deeper truths -- I mean that both spiritually and psychologically. So the challenge is to trust that God is in this with us and to hold on until whatever the graces are that God is going bring out of this are revealed. Its a long Good Friday and Holy Saturday, though, he explained.

The impact on children

Dawson said that the lockdown could have an especially detrimental impact on children. A report from the Childhood Trust last month concluded that the pandemic put children at risk of developing serious mental health problems, including post-traumatic stress, with acute challenges for those living in poverty.

Most of a childs world is taken up with school and family -- thats usually 80-90% of most childrens world, Dawson said.

Now, when school is taken out of the equation and when you lose access to all of your friends, thats extraordinarily difficult. I think we can expect this to have both emotional impact and cognitive impact. By that I mean an impact on both cognitive development and in terms of education, and social and emotional consequences. Six months is a long time for a child.

He said that the crisis had exposed the chasm between the comfortable and the uncomfortable, and that Catholics should be inspired by Catholic social teaching to challenge the status quo.

Hard consolation

Dawson suggested that the spirituality of St. Ignatius of Loyola could also shed light on what people have experienced during the coronavirus crisis. In particular, he highlighted the saints teaching about consolation and desolation.

He said: Consolation is, classically, marked by increases in faith, hope and love. Typically, theres energy and joy and life that go with that. Desolation is the reverse: heart-sinking despair, closing in on ourselves, often focusing on ourselves, and decreases of faith, hope and love, feeling less trusting and confident.

Now, the thing about consolation is that it normally sounds like a nice feeling, and it often is. But it isnt always. Theres what Ignatius calls hard consolation, which is the consolation of being in the right place at the right time doing the right thing even though it might be really, really tough.

So someone could be at the bedside of a friend whos dying painfully of cancer, but theyre aware that Gods with them, and theyre aware that theyre in the right place at the right time doing the right thing.

He gave the example of Mary standing at the foot of the cross.

She didnt know what the future was, didnt know what God was up to, but she was with her Son, with God, trusting, faithful, and waiting for the future to reveal itself. Because as Christians we believe that that future will be good and hopeful. Thats the ground for our hope, he said.

For those who had mainly experienced desolation during the crisis, he said it was important not to blame oneself for it, but rather to learn from it.

The temptation in desolation is to give up all the other things, so to stop praying, stop your normal religious practices. But you keep faithful to those, trusting that it will pass.

He also recommended returning to previous sources of consolation, such as friends, family, and nature.

He said he had found consolation in the nature surrounding St. Beunos, where the poet Gerard Manley Hopkins lived and studied in 1874-7.

Im in an incredibly beautiful environment here at St. Beunos, and just simply going out and looking closely at some of the plants in the gardens: it grounds me. These are small instances of consolation which might not radically change my psychological or spiritual state, but it does remind me of the beauty and wonder of creation, he said.

The Spiritual Opportunity of Working on Your Own Racism – Patheos

To know love, become we. Mevlana

Four years ago, as a journalist, I wrote a profile of the Black Lives Matter chapter in Louisville, Kentucky and the parallel movement of white advocates that had emerged to support it. I took on the assignment because I wanted to understand BLM as a new civil rights movement. But reporting the article took me into unexpected emotional and spiritual territory. I had not felt how terrifying it can be to live as a Black person in America. And I did not fully grasp the part I as a white person play in supporting that racist system.

At the time, it seemed like enough to write the story and see it published. But now, as I have been watching the police brutality protests unfold over the past few weeks around the world, but especially in Louisville, where many of the people I met during my reporting as well as other friends are involved, it feels important to share what I see as the spiritual opportunity of addressing the unconscious racism in oneself.

Race has to be one of the most difficult subjects to talk about, if not the top taboo for white people (at least for Americans). Part of what makes it so vexing is that it is a collective belief, one which underpins our social operating system, and yet it is experienced individually. If you havent experienced yourself as a systematically racialized other, you might imagine that racism is a personal problem rather than a collective one.

I have only felt hints of what it is like myself. Mostly this has taken the form of one question I have gotten over and over in my life: Where are you from? No I mean your ethnic background. This question is more commonly aimed at people of color and/or Muslims, and can be a subtle way of communicating I dont think you belong here. In my case, I think the question has mostly been motivated by idle curiosity it has never gotten me pulled aside for extra security screening or cost me a job interview but it has given me some sense of how much it can damage your sense of yourself as a whole person when others only perceive you as a set of physical features: your hair, your cheekbones, your skin.

I will also say that I have a small experience of what it means to pass, albeit through the structures of class rather than race. My grandparents, aunts and uncles were all working people: cleaning ladies, garbage men, gas station attendants, truck drivers. My parents both worked in factories but put all of their resources towards giving my sister and me an education.

College was the family dream as well as my own idea of making it. But when I finally went off to the liberal-arts college on the other side of the country that I had chosen so carefully, it was a shock to discover that I did not fit in. Of course my clothes and hair were all wrong, but it was more than that it was like I spoke a different language. I didnt get the references the other students made in conversation. They also made fun of my accent, sometimes to the point of saying they couldnt understand me.

I felt ashamed of who I was and where I had come from. I resolved to better myself by becoming like my middle-class peers in every surface way. I imitated their clothes, their hobbies, how they talked and what they talked about until they took me as one of their own: no more curious looks or semi-insulting questions. That first kind of passing allowed me to later make a career out of seeing how far I could pass in the various clubs of the middle-class professional world: corporate America, the art world, high tech.

Yet I still felt other on the inside. And I believe this feeling of being outside of the mainstream, of thinking and believing differently, in part because of the experience of being treated differently, helped guide me to the spiritual path. I was especially drawn to Sufism for its emphasis on inner qualities over outer forms, and for its teachings on love as a discipline rather than a sentimental indulgence.

All of this came together when I recently read Layla Saads blog post I need to talk to spiritual white women about white supremacy. I realized that despite the experiences which have helped me imagine how painful and maddening it must be to live as a person of color in our society, I have been perpetuating that system through my own white silence. I have let comments or situations pass without saying at the very least that the comment made me feel uncomfortable. I let the situations pass for the usual reason: going along to get along, out of the fear that I would upset another white person or that it would create some kind of scene I wouldnt know how to manage or get out of. And when it comes to those I am close to, the fear has been that I probably wouldnt change their mind but I could end up damaging our relationship.

But in Sufism we are told that a dervish must not fear. The way I understand that injunction is that we must set aside our egos fears for its own comfort and security, as these are the main causes of separation from the Divine Reality and an authentic relationship with other people (and what could be a more concise definition of racism)?

If I want to know true love and wholeness for myself then I need to do the work of reconciliation and wholeness, as the Quran reminds us in Surah Maryam*.

Two points in Saads piece in particular resonated for me with our Path. For white people who say they want to be allies to people of color, she writes, Saying Yes to doing this work is only the first step. Your Yes means:

YES to seeing my spirituality as a way to engage deeper into this work rather than as a way to bypass this work, and to recognizing that being devoted to Spirit means being devoted to social justice.

YES to doing this work every day, even when I get it wrong, even when its hard, even when it feels like Im not good enough at it because its not about me.

My dear sister Saimma Dyers blog post on sacred activism explains the connection between social justice and Sufism far better than I can. What I can say out of my own observation is that, unlike the civil rights movement of the 1960s, which was led by spiritual leaders such as Dr King and Malcolm X, it does not seem that todays leaders are holding a prophetic vision of a just society. Perhaps it is up to us as everyday spiritual activists to hold that vision ourselves.

Speaking out for, and living in service of a larger ideal, is another way of saying its not about me. So much of our work as dervishes is already about escaping the prison of me to come into the rose garden of friendship. Whiteness is just another layer of the false self to be shed. By embracing the work of undoing our own racial conditioning, there is a spiritual opportunity to embrace humanity not as a lofty ideal but in the day-to-day messiness of real relationships.

In a Hadith Qudsi, the Divine tells us, When I love my faithful servant, I am the hearing by which she or he hears, the eye by which she or he sees and the foot by which she or he walks. That is a promise which can also be read in the other direction, as an invitation to step into the Divine perspective. In other words: if Haqq were the lens through which we perceived the world, we would not experience ourselves as a lone being separate from others on the basis of race, gender, nationality, religion, class, or a myriad other identifications. We would experience ourselves instead as an individuated aspect of the Divine Reality: a ray of light refracted into a variety of hues, all emanating from the same Source. Our challenge now as spiritual activists is to speak out for the truth of that perspective and do the work of living it.

*VERILY, those who attain to faith and do righteous deeds will the Most Gracious endow with love; Quran 19:96, Muhammad Asad translation

Suikoden Creators On Making A Spiritual Successor To The Classic JRPG – GameSpot

The original PlayStation is renowned for its diverse library of games, but no genre is as synonymous with the system as JRPGs. In its five-year lifespan, the console produced a staggering number of instant classics, including three beloved Final Fantasy games, Chrono Cross, Vagrant Story, and Suikoden II, among others. Yoshitaka Murayama, the original creator behind the latter, is hoping to recapture that golden era of JRPGs with his next venture, Eiyuden Chronicle: Hundred Heroes.

Earlier this year, Murayama and a handful of other industry veterans founded Rabbit & Bear Studios, an independent development studio based in Tokyo, Japan. The company's first project, Eiyuden Chronicle, is a classical turn-based RPG forged in the mold of Suikoden II.

"The first thing we decided when our members came together was, 'It's about time we made a really interesting game that we ourselves want to make,'" Murayama said in a press release. Perhaps unsurprisingly, Eiyuden Chronicle revisits the themes and aesthetic that defined his PlayStation-era work.

The visuals in particular evoke the feel of Murayama's PS One classic. The game features a striking 2.5D graphical style that's reminiscent of Octopath Traveler, Square Enix's own consciously retro RPG. This likeness isn't coincidental. "From a graphical perspective, Octopath Traveler has inspired us and given us hope that there is a mid-point between new and old that a wide audience can appreciate," Murayama tells GameSpot over email.

Working alongside Murayama on the project are other Suikoden veterans Junko Kawano (Suikoden, Suikoden IV) and Osamu Komuta (Suikoden Tactics, Suikoden Tierkreis), as well as Junichi Murakami (Castlevania: Aria of Sorrow). For Murayama and Kawano, Eiyuden Chronicle marks the first time in 25 years that the two have collaborated on a project, but that long gap has not been a hurdle. "I wish I could say we've all grown and changed in many ways but it feels like nothing has changed in the last 25 years!" Kawano says. "But it definitely feels like you are seeing long lost friends from your hometown that you have missed dearly. I'm sure it feels like some strange time-warp."

Like its spiritual predecessors, Eiyuden Chronicle's story is told against the backdrop of war. The game follows a young warrior named Nowa and his friend, Seign Kesling. Nowa hails from a small village in a remote corner of the League of Nations, while Seign is an imperial officer for the Galdean Empire, a militarily advanced nation that has discovered how to amplify the magical powers of an artifact called "rune-lens." With this power, the empire is marching into the other territories around the continent of Allraan in search of more artifacts that can be used to bolster its hold over the land.

As fate would have it, Nowa also happens upon a rune-lens while out on a mission, and the discovery will ultimately ignite a confrontation between the League of Nations and the Galdean Empire--and test his friendship with Seign. This is a theme that has long intrigued Murayama. "One of the main themes I like to focus on is 'What is a hero,' but also, how do friendships and relationships affect the course of history?," Murayama says. "A single choice to stand up for a friend or alliance can be the spark that starts a world-altering war. I find that terribly interesting."

Suikoden's signature hallmark is its expansive cast; every entry features more than 100 unique recruitable characters, each of whom plays a role in the overarching story, and it's clear from the subtitle that Eiyuden Chronicle will continue that tradition. Much like Suikoden, the game will have 100 heroes to recruit, and as these characters join your ranks, you'll gradually build up a fortress base. Naturally, coming up with backstories and unique personalities for such an extensive cast is a challenge.

"Of course it's a major hassle," Murayama says. "You not only have to create 100 characters and their backstories but additionally how they all relate and the role they will serve. It's an incredibly complicated web. And even from the beginning, as the subtitle states, this is a tale about heroes. So our hope is to work with the community to build out these very heroes very much as the community also organically grows."

For Kawano, who serves as Eiyuden Chronicle's lead artist and character designer, this expansive cast list presents a different sort of challenge. "It's not hard to create new characters," Kawano says. "In a title like this where you have to create a huge amount, it's more about endurance. Especially towards the end of development you are cramming so many things in last- minute. However, the hard part is after you are done and out of 'runway' you invariably feel like you missed the opportunity to add this character or that character. So that regret is the worst part."

Although Eiyuden Chronicle deliberately harkens back to Suikoden and other classic JRPGs in many ways, Murayama hopes the game will be viewed on its own merits. "I don't want to be defined by my past," he says. "This game represents an extension of some of the gameplay and systems that I have honed over my many years as a game developer, but it is a new title and needs to stand on its own.

"Eiyuden represents a major challenge for us. At the core of that challenge is for us to make a game that is intensely satisfying and just flat-out fun. While many people have doubts and issues with crowdfunding and Kickstarter, it still remains the best chance an old creator like myself has to own IP and to interact with a serious group of fans who are investing in the project from the ground up. Something that takes serious commitment. It may sound cheesy but it's easy to doubt and be negative. It takes a true hero to believe in something."

Rabbit & Bear is raising funds to develop Eiyuden Chronicle through Kickstarter. The crowdfunding campaign runs until August 28, although it has already proven to be an overwhelming success; donations blew past the studio's original $500,000 goal in only two hours and hit the $1 million stretch goal to bring the game to consoles in less than a day. The team is humbled by the positive response from fans, writing on Twitter: "I can't believe it was funded so quickly! Many people have no hope in Kickstarter so I was so afraid. Thank you so much my heroes!!!! I will make a great game for you!"

Eiyuden Chronicle is tentatively planned to launch in Fall 2022.

Understanding Hinduism: 4 Vedas the fountain heads of spirituality – Tehelka

Yajurveda (700-300 BC) has been dealt with in a treatise called Hindu World where it is described as the second Veda, compiled mainly from Rig-vedic hymns, but showing considerable deviation from the original Rig-vedic text. It also has prose passages of a later date. The Yajur-veda, like the Sama-veda samhita (collection), introduces a geographical milieu different from that of the Rig-veda. It is not so much the Indus and its tributaries any more, but the areas of the Satlej, Jamna and Ganges rivers.

The Yajur-veda represents a transition between the spontaneous, free-worshipping period of the Rig-veda and the later brahmanical period when ritualism had become firmly established. It is a priestly handbook, arranged in liturgical form for the performance of sacrifices (yaja), as its name implies. It embodies the sacrificial formulas in their entirety, prescribes rules for the construction of altars, for the new and full-moon sacrifices, the rajasuya, the asvamedha, and the soma sacrifices. Strict observance of the ceremonial in every detail was insisted upon, and deviations led to the formation of new schools, there being over one hundred Yajur-vedic schools at the time of Patanjali (200 BC). Much of the sakha literature grew up out of variants of the Yajur-vedic texts.

In the Yajur-veda the sacrifice becomes so important that even the gods are compelled to do the will of the brahimns. Religion becomes a mechanical ritual in which crowds of priests conduct vast and complicated ceremonies whose effects are believed to be felt in the farthermost heavens. Its under-lying principles were so ridden with superstition and belief in the power of the priests to do and undo the cosmic order itself that critics have likened their formulas to the ravings of mental delirium. The priest especially associated with the Yajur-vedic ceremonial was the adhvaryu.

The Yajur-veda now consists of two samhitas, which once existed in one hundred and one recensions. Both the samhitas contain almost the same subject matter but differently arranged. The Taittiriya Samhita, commonly called the Black Yajur-veda for its obscurity of meaning, was known in the third century BC, and is the older of the two. It has been described as an undigested jumble of different pieces, and as having a motley character. In this samhita the distinction between the Mantra and the Brahmana portions is not as clear as in the other Vedas.

The Vajasaneyi Samhita, or the White Yajur-veda, was communicated to the sage Yajasaneti Samhita by the Sun God in his equine form. It has a much more methodical arrangement and brings order and light, as opposed to the confusion and darkness of the Black Yajur-veda. In the book titled Sacred Scriptures of India it says that Yajurveda inspires humans to walk on the path of Karma and that is why it is also referred to as Karma-Veda. The essence of the Yajurveda lies in those mantras (incantations) that inspire people to initiate action. It further says that there are many branches of Yajurveda but two branches, namely, Krishna and Shukla Yajurveda have gained relatively more prominence, i.e., Krishna Yajurveda and Shukla Yajurveda. Besides it, it says that Yajurveda was later on named as Taitareya Samhita.

Sama-veda (c. 700-300 BC) (saman, melody), the third Veda. Its samhita or principal part is wholly metrical, consisting of 1549 verses, of which only 75 are not traceable to the Rig-veda. The stanzas are arranged in two books or collections of verses. The Sama-veda embodies the knowledge of melodies and chants. The samhita of this Veda served as a textbook for the priests who officiated at the Soma sacrifices. It indicates the tunes to which the sacred hymns are to be sung, by showing the prolongation, the repetition and interpolation of syllables required in the singing. The Sama-veda also contains a detailed account of the soma rites. The hierophants associated with the Sama-veda are known as the udgatri.

Many of the invocations in the Sama-veda are addressed to Soma, some to Agni and some to Indra. The mantra part of the Sama-veda is poor in literary quality and historical interest, but the Brahmanas belonging to it are important. Of the once numerous samhitas of the Samaveda (the Puranas speak of a thousand) only one has reached us, in three recensions, namely: the Kauthama, current in Gujarat, the Ranayaniya which survives in Maharashtra, and the Jaiminiya in the Karnatic.

In the Sacred Scriptures of India it is described that the compilation of Richas (Shlokas) is known as Sama. Sama is dependent on the Richas. The beauty of speech lied in the Richas. The beauty of Richas lie in the sama and the beauty of the same lies in the style of pronunciation and singing. The knowledge of sama, therefore, is Samaveda. This refers to Geeta-10/22 where Shri Krishna has stated the importance of Samaveda in the following manner: Vedamana Samavedo Asmi meaning I am samaveda myself amongst the Vedas.

There are two parts of the Samaveda (1) Purvarchik (2) Uttararchik. In between both of them is Mahanamnayarchik which comprises of 10 incantations. There are four parts of Purvarchika Aagneya, Aendra, Paavmaan and Aasanya.

Atharvaveda is considered in Hindu World as the fourth Veda, of whose origin there has been much contentious speculation. It is also referred to as the Brahma-veda because it served as the manual of the chief sacrificial priests, the brahmins. A great deal is said in the Atharva-veda hymns about the brahmins and the honours due to them. One-sixth of the work is not metrical, and about one-six of the hymns are also found among the hymns of the Rig-veda, mostly in the first, eight and tenth books. The rest of the subject matter is peculiar to the Atharva-veda, This Veda was once current in nine different redactions, of which only two, the Pippalada and Sunaka recensions are extant, the former in a single unpublished Tubingen manuscript discovered by Roth.

The Atharva-veda embodies the magical formulary of ancient India, and much of it is devoted to spells, incantations, chants and charms. In general the charms and spells are divided into two classes; they are either bheshajani, which are of medicinal, healing and peaceful nature, dealing with cures and herbs for treating fever, leprosy, jaundice, dropsy and other diseases; this class includes prayers for successful childbirth, love spells, charms for fecundity, for the recovery of virility, hymns for the birth of sons, and a quaint chant to put the household to sleep while the lover steals into the girls home at night. Or else they belong to the abhichara class, which are of a bewitching and malevolent nature; these include spells for producing diseases and bringing ill-luck to enemies. Among them is a spell that a woman may use against her rival to make her remain a spinster; another spell is meant to destroy a mans virility, and so forth. There are hymns to serpents and demons, and incantations replete with witchcraft, sorcery and black magic.

One of the reputed authors of the Atharva-veda was the Rishi Atharvan, of Maga of Persian ancestry. But certain parts, especially the verses dealing with the rites of sorcerers and wizards were attributed to the Rishi Angiras, of pre-Aryan, probably Dravidian stock. The hymns were said to have been collected by Sumantu, a Rishi of great antiquity who bequeathed the material to Rishi Vyasa for arranging.

The Atharva-veda is the most interesting of the sruti, for it has preserved to a great extent a solid core of pre-Aryan and non-Aryan tradition. It is unique among the texts of Vedic period and an important source of information regarding popular religious belief, not so far modified by priestly religion. It reveals in fact a vast substratum of indigenous doctrine that is not only non-Vedic but at times contra-Vedic.

Scholars trace Mesopotamian influences in the Atharva-veda, among them Dr. Bhandarkar, who discerns in it the magical lore of the Asuras. Others see evidence of Vratya and Maga Doctrines. The Vishnu Purana and the Bhavishya Purana speak of the Angiras as one of the four Vedas of the Magas. The foreign words occurring in the Atharva-veda, which Tilak traced to Chaldea, may have been only strange to Sanskrit, and may well have formed part of the regular vocabulary of the Maga priests.

For long the Atharva-veda was not included among the other three Vedas. Although the Vedas are now said to be four in number this was not the originally recognized number of the compilations. The oldest records refer to only three Vedas, namely, the Rig, Sama and Yajur. Manu speaks of these as the trayi (triad) milked out from the fire, air, and sun, and the Atharva-veda was not even acknowledged in his time. There is no reference to it in the Chhandogya Upanishad; the Brahmana texts mention only three Vedas; the Jatakas know of only three.

This would seem to indicate not that the Atharvaveda was non-existent at the time the other Vedas were composed, but that it did not for several centuries form part of the sacred scriptures of the Aryans. Of its canonical status today it has been said that influential scholars of South India still deny the genuineness of the Atharva-veda. While discussing this Veda in the treatise titled the Sacred Scriptures of India, this Veda is described as devoid of movement or concentration. The word Tharva means fickleness or movement and accordingly the word Atharva means that which is unwavering, concentrated or unchanging. That is why it is said: Tharva Gati Karma Na Tharva Eti Atharva.

The philosophy of Yoga speaks that: Yogash Chitta Vritti Nirodhah, which means controlling the different impulses of the mind and senses in Yoga. The Gita re-iterates that when the mind is free from impulses and flaws, the mind becomes stable and the person becomes neutral when the impulses of the mind and the other senses are in control, then only the mind is freed from instability and perturbances. The word Atharva therefore refers to neutrality of personality. The Atharvaveda speaks more about Yoga, the human physiology, different ailments, social structure, spirituality, appreciation of natural beauty, national religion, etc. This knowledge is practical and is worth bringing in use. This Veda is a fusion of prose and poetry together. Ayurveda is considered to be the Upaveda (Sub-Veda) of this Veda. This write up highlights the spiritual aspects of Vedas only. Beyond Zoom: can virtual reality replace the classroom experience? – Times Higher Education (THE)

With fears still high that Covid-19 could run rampant when campuses reopen next month, online learning looks set to play a major role at most universities for the foreseeable future.

But will the same mix of Skype lectures, virtual seminars and online learning materials that students patiently accepted at the end of last semester cut it for a full year of academic teaching? Many think not and wonder whether virtual reality (VR) might provide a more engaging learning experience than the basic teleconferencing method adopted in lockdown.

It wont solve everything, but it could be an important part of the mix, explained Lyron Bentovim, chief executive officer of the Glimpse Group, a New York-based VR company, who has used the technology to teach students at Fordham University, where he is a professor of entrepreneurship.

In Professor Bentovims classes, business students wearing VR headsets can hold virtual round-table discussions in which they appear as animated avatars and can also split into breakout groups to discuss certain issues. They can even make business pitches to simulated crowds an experience that is hard to recreate even in more normal pre-coronavirus times, said Professor Bentovim.

The great thing about VR learning is that it goes to a certain part of the brain, so that when students are eventually faced with a room of strangers, they feel like: Ive done this, he said.

That type of interactive learning lacks the excitement of vast, detailed alternative universes that many hoped VR would provide. But, for Professor Bentovim, this more realistic view of how VR might work at scale in higher education is a good thing.

You can do some phenomenal things with the tech, but you can also do far easier stuff that helps students learn how to network, negotiate and present to a classroom, he says.

Indeed, pitching a business idea to a panel of avatars is, for many, preferable to a typical Dragons Den-style encounter. Its much less intimidating for students, he said.

Nonetheless, more complicated bespoke worlds can be created to order, explained Hugh Seaton, chief executive of Adept Reality, a subsidiary of Glimpse Group, which recently recreated Shakespeares Globe Theatre for students taking summer school classes at Sacred Heart University in Connecticut.

You can have videos of lions jumping out and other bespoke things, but we want to build tools that professors can [use] themselves, explained Mr Seaton. Id say its no more complicated than using [the virtual learning environment] Blackboard, which most academics use every day, he said.

One reason why VR has failed to go mainstream is that the price of the hardware has not fallen as many had expected: the most favoured type of headset, Oculus Rift, retails at about 400, although cheaper versions are available at about 310.

If students are barred from campus after a coronavirus outbreak, however, that cost proposition seems a bit different when many US students are paying $40,000 (30,800) a year, said Mr Seaton. Its basically two or three sets of lab fees, and youre not just paying for a set of beakers you cant keep, he added.

Others are less sure that VR is a viable alternative to Zoom or Skype. Around 2015, Glenn Gunhouse, professor of art history at Georgia State University, set out to use VR to teach the history of architecture. However, it became clear that the costs were prohibitivepartly because Ifeared committing to a technology that might quickly become obsolete.

Enrolment in my classes also increased beyond what any campus computing lab could have handled, added Professor Gunhouse.

Student access to reliable broadband internet service was another challenge. When our courses were switched online, many of my students could not evenview the videos and PowerPoints that replaced my in-person lectures, he said.

Using VR for a class of 12 or fewer, however, may be more viable, he admitted. Although participants appear only as avatars, the fact that they look three-dimensional and seem to exist in a 3D space gives a more realistic sense of meeting together than viewing a mosaic of 2D headshots, he said.

The imminent arrival of 5G internet, which will operate about 10 times faster than 4G, might also speed the adoption of VR, said James Bennett, professor of television and digital culture at Royal Holloway, University of London, who is leading the 5 million StoryFutures research project, which aims to help the UKs 1,000 or so immersive storytelling companies to grow, with VR and augmented reality (AR) training predicted to be an $8.5 billion industry by 2023.

As the UK rolls out 5G, headsets will get a lot lighter theyll be more like sunglasses, explained Professor Bennett. As it is, headset sales have gone through the roof its really difficult to buy them because lots of different industries are engaging with the idea of training people at a distance.

Professor Bennetts project will involve eight train the trainers groups helping to improve VR competencies in UK universities, with computer scientists working alongside academics from the creative industries to ensure a truly engaging VR experience.

Were developing a set of lecturers who can embed immersive storytelling throughout the courses by giving them the time, budget and industry know-how to do this, he explained. Technology is important, but having professional-level creative experiences front and centre will be just as key to ensuring VR learning works.

Virgin Galactic offers a peek inside SpaceShipTwo in VR, making its case in the space tourism race – GeekWire

A computer rendering shows the seat configuration for the SpaceShipTwo passenger cabin, looking toward a mirror wall at the back of the cabin. (Virgin Galactic Illustration)

More than a decade after Virgin Galactic unveiled a swoopy, spacey look for the passenger cabin of its SpaceShipTwo rocket plane, the company took the wraps off a more down-to-Earth design that reflects what spacefliers will actually see when they climb into their seats.

And in a move befitting this era of social distancing, the big reveal was done with the aid of virtual reality.

Virgin Galactic went so far as to lend out Oculus Quest headsets to journalists, including yours truly, so we could get an advance peek at a computer-generated interior with an eye-filling view of Earth and space out the window.

The VR experience let me do something I could never do during a real-life rocket ride: walk through the walls of the spaceship, stand on the wing and step off into space. The thought experiment was a cosmic version of the classic VR game where you walk on a plank sticking out from the ledge of a virtual skyscraper and dare yourself to jump off. I couldnt do it from SpaceShipTwo Unitys wing unless I kept my eyes closed.

Virgin Galactics re-reveal of the cabin design was one of a series of unveilings leading up to the start of commercial suborbital space tours which could start later this year, depending on the course of the coronavirus pandemic. Other unveilings included last years inside look at Virgin Galactics Gateway to Space terminal at Spaceport America in New Mexico, and the debut of a spacewear clothing line created by Under Armour.

Its all meant to whet the appetite of the more than 600 customers in 60 countries who already hold reservations for suborbital spaceflights, at a cost of $250,000, and attract more sign-ups at whats expected to be a higher ticket price. This comes amid a rivalry with Amazon CEO Jeff Bezos Blue Origin space venture and fellow billionaire Elon Musks SpaceX for shares of a space tourism market thatsexpected to grow to $3 billion annually by 2030.

Giving hundreds of people the opportunity to experience rocket-powered spaceflight, if only for a brief time, goes back to a vision that Microsoft co-founder Paul Allen bought into more than 15 years ago by financing SpaceShipOne, the prize-winning precursor of Virgin Galactics SpaceShipTwo.

The headset gives you a visual taste of what those spacefliers will experience. Although the VR experience makes use of computer-generated static scenes rather than full-motion video, the sounds that you hear including cockpit chatter and the rumble of the rocket engine add to the sense of realism.

Years ago, I took part in a training session with would-be spacefliers that involved sitting on six folding chairs and trying to imagine how wed get around SpaceShipTwos cabin. I wouldnt be at all surprised if future trainees wore headsets to add the sights and sounds of spaceflight to the exercise.

Lets start with the seats, which are arranged in threes on each side of a middle aisle.

Those seats, developed by the London-based design firm Seymourpowell, look much more mainstream than the 2001-style curved couches that Virgin Galactic founder Richard Branson showed off at a 2006 preview. Nevertheless, there are some unconventional twists, including:

Some of the seats can be removed to accommodate scientific payloads. Such payloads are already being put on SpaceShipTwos test flights but once Virgin Galactic starts passenger service, researchers can fly alongside their experiments.

Twelve circular portholes, each equipped with mood lighting and a camera, line the cabins walls and ceiling ensuring that every passenger has multiple choices for looking out at the New Mexico terrain below during the 45-minute ascent to SpaceShipTwos air launch, and for looking out into space (or at Earth) during several minutes worth of floating in weightlessness.

Virgin Galactic says the cabin has been lined with cushy foam to soften the inevitable bumping around that comes with zero-G gymnastics in close quarters. And at the back of the cabin, theres a wall-to-wall mirror surface that passengers can use to watch themselves as they float.

We think theres a real memory burn that customers are going to have when they see that analog reflection of themselves at the back of the cabin, seeing themselves floating freely in space, Jeremy Brown, Virgin Galactics design director, said during a post-reveal Zoom news briefing.

Virgin Galactics chief space officer, George Whitesides, said that discussions with the companys customers fed into the design process. The interior of the spaceship was designed with one thing in mind: the view of the Earth from space, he said.

Will spacefliers consider the ride spacey enough? I cant wait to hear the real-life reviews once passengers start flying. And once Amazon CEO Jeff Bezos Blue Origin space venture starts putting passengers on its New Shepard suborbital spaceship, sometime in the next year or two, deep-pocketed space travelers just might sit around after their flights and debate the comparative advantages of Virgin Galactics mirror wall versus Blue Origins bigger windows.

If only we could all afford to sample the suborbital space smorgasbord! Come to think of it, maybe we can in virtual reality.

Virgin Galactics spaceship cabin reveal is the subject of a YouTube video, and an augmented-reality mobile app showcasing the cabin can be downloaded for free via Apples App Store for iOS and the Google Play Store for Android.

How AI is Pushing Virtual Reality To The Next Level – AI Daily

Computer Graphics

For VR environments to be fully immersive, we must strive towards graphics that can mirror reality. Unfortunately, such high-level graphics are difficult to attain in real-time without running into problems with framerate and stuttering gameplay, which breaks immersion and can cause motion sickness in players. The consequence of this is that the majority of VR experiences must use simplistic graphics to keep the experience as smooth as possible.

Fortunately, computer graphics titans Nvidia have been utilising deep learning techniques to make such dreams possible. "Deep Learning Super Sampling" is a technology developed by Nvidia which allows high-resolution images to be generated for a low-res image input, allowing for high-quality graphics for VR to be less costly than before. By developing AI-based technologies like this and integrating them into our VR experiences, realistic, immersive graphics can be produced with greater efficiency, cost and speed.

More Intelligent Training

VR has proven to be a great tool for training people to perform high-risk tasks without the risk, for example by simulating operations for trainee doctors, and engine failure scenarios for pilots. By implementing AI into VR simulations training could be more intelligently analysed and better respond to the user's actions giving a more customised experience with accurate feedback.

Headset Tracking using Computer Vision

The Oculus Quest, a VR headset made by Facebook-owned company Oculus, employs AI-enabled computer vision to compute the user's movements and ensure that they never wander out of a set playspace without being notified by the system. This is done by using the exterior cameras on the headset to create a virtual map of the room. An AI algorithm will identify recognisable points that can be used to identify the headset's exact position in the room in real-time. This means that any movement you make is translated accurately into the game and if you get too close to a real-life obstacle, the headset will give you a suitable warning.
